Well SOE wouldn't pull the plug just because there is another SW game out there. Though Lucas might, not sure of the level of contractual control LA has.

You could break it down into a flowchart:

1. Does Lucas Arts have the control to shut down SWG just because they want to? Y/N?  If yes, it gets closed. If not go to number 2.

2. After TOR launches, does SWG maintain enough subs to be profitable: Y/N? If yes SWG stays open, if not it gets closed.

The only vagueness would come from just maybe SOE would love to have an excuse to shutdown SWG just because of all the bad press its generated for them over time.

Taking all that into account, I'd be surprised if SWG is open a year after TOR launches, if TOR is more than moderately successful.
